1. A method for measuring cardiac output (CO) of a patient, comprising the following steps:

  • sensing arterial blood pressure and converting the sensed arterial blood pressure to a pressure signal;

    calculating an estimate of stroke volume as a function only of selected characteristics of the sensed pressure signal, including calculating an area (A) under the entire pressure signal including both pulsatile and non-pulsatile portions of the pressure signal; and

    calculating an estimate of CO as a function of the estimated stroke volume and a current heart rate value.
